Yeah.  Sometimes it depends on the gametype or even the map.  If you're running around with a hectic team anywhere, you're going to spawn in some crazy ass places.  If you've got a team establishing order, with a plan, spawns aren't bad at all on most maps.

Even with a good team spawns can still get pretty fucked if you have an enemy close to your teammates. Hell, they don't really have to be that close. Too many times I've gone from 7 and 0 just to die and then spawn in the middle of the other team. My 7 and 1 quickly becomes an 8 and 5 by the time I get back to my team.

 

Or you have a map locked down and an enemy spawns behind you – even when the entire team is still in your original spawn. Stonehaven is a prime example.

I have maybe played 3 games of Dom, and no idea if one of those were on Stonehaven.  Typically the team will migrate away from the broken house at the start of the game and a sniper or marksman will drop an enemy right off the bat.  That enemy will then immediately spawn behind us even though he should be spawning back by his team in his original spawn as that is theoretically the safest place for him to spawn.  So no, it is not my teams fault but the designers of the spawn system.
